活动介绍
file-type

2020版SQL语句大全:Mysql与SQL常用语句集锦

ZIP文件

下载需积分: 50 | 325KB | 更新于2025-04-25 | 99 浏览量 | 14 下载量 举报 2 收藏
download 立即下载
根据您提供的文件信息,我们可以提炼出以下知识点: 1. SQL语句的分类和用途 SQL(Structured Query Language)语句是用于管理关系型数据库的标准编程语言。SQL语句可以分为几类,包括数据查询语言(DQL)、数据操作语言(DML)、数据定义语言(DDL)、数据控制语言(DCL)以及事务控制语言(TCL)。 - 数据查询语言(DQL):用于查询数据库中的数据,主要关键字包括SELECT。 - 数据操作语言(DML):用于插入、更新、删除数据库中的数据,主要关键字包括INSERT、UPDATE、DELETE。 - 数据定义语言(DDL):用于定义和修改数据库结构,主要关键字包括CREATE、ALTER、DROP。 - 数据控制语言(DCL):用于控制数据访问权限,主要关键字包括GRANT、REVOKE。 - 事务控制语言(TCL):用于管理数据库事务,主要关键字包括COMMIT、ROLLBACK。 2. Mysql数据库 MySQL是一种流行的开源关系型数据库管理系统(RDBMS),由瑞典MySQL AB公司开发。它使用结构化查询语言(SQL)进行数据库管理,并且是目前最流行的开源数据库之一。MySQL适用于各种不同的应用场合,具有高性能、高可靠性和易用性等特点。 3. SQL的必知必会内容 "必知必会"是指在使用SQL进行数据库操作时,需要掌握的基础和常用知识点。这包括但不限于: - SQL基础语法:理解SQL的语句结构和关键词的使用。 - 数据类型和函数:熟悉常用的数据类型如INT、VARCHAR、DATE等,以及SQL内置函数的运用。 - 条件查询:掌握使用WHERE子句进行条件筛选。 - 联合查询:理解JOIN语句的使用,包括INNER JOIN、LEFT JOIN、RIGHT JOIN等。 - 子查询:了解子查询的概念,并能应用于复杂的查询需求。 - 分组和聚合:掌握GROUP BY和HAVING子句的使用,进行数据分组统计。 - 数据操作:熟练运用INSERT、UPDATE、DELETE等语句进行数据操作。 - 索引管理:了解索引的概念以及如何创建和使用索引优化查询。 4. 实际开发中的SQL语句应用 在实际的软件开发中,SQL语句的运用尤为重要。开发者需要根据业务需求,编写高效、安全的SQL代码。这可能包括: - 复杂查询:构建多表连接、子查询等复杂SQL语句。 - 事务处理:使用COMMIT和ROLLBACK语句管理数据库事务。 - 权限管理:通过GRANT和REVOKE语句控制对数据库的访问权限。 - 性能优化:编写索引、使用EXPLAIN语句分析查询性能等。 - 防止SQL注入:合理使用参数化查询或者预编译语句来提高安全性。 5. 文件内容 该压缩包内文件名为“2020年最新版SQL语句大全(建议收藏).pdf”,这表明文件可能是包含了最新版的SQL语句示例及其用法说明的电子书格式。读者可以从文件中了解到上述所有知识点,以及具体的SQL语句示例和操作步骤。 6. 文件推荐 描述中提到博主耗费了大量时间整理SQL语句大全,并且特别推荐给读者。这说明文件内容质量较高,可能是经过作者精心筛选和分类,具有很高的参考价值。特别是对于数据库管理人员、开发人员以及正在学习SQL的新手,这个大全可以作为学习和工作的参考资料。 以上知识点涉及到了SQL语句的基础和进阶使用,数据库的管理和操作,以及安全和优化方面。对于IT行业专业人员以及数据库爱好者来说,理解和掌握这些知识点是必不可少的。同时,由于数据库在众多IT领域中的基础性作用,这些知识点同样适用于各种与数据库打交道的IT职位。

相关推荐

Geek_H
  • 粉丝: 1059
上传资源 快速赚钱